thermal: gov_power_allocator: Use .manage() callback instead of .throttle()
The Power Allocator governor really only wants to be called once per thermal zone update and it does a special check to skip the extra, from its perspective, invocations of the .throttle() callback. Make it use .manage() instead of .throttle(). Signed-off-by: Rafael J. Wysocki <rafael.j.wysocki@intel.com> Reviewed-by: Lukasz Luba <lukasz.luba@arm.com>
